The curtain has gone up on The Alexandra theatre in Birmingham after a £650,000 refurbishment project.
A new facade was created as part of the work at the theatre, which was built in 1901. It was originally sited on Station Street, where the venue’s Stage Door and Access entrance are now located.
A bridge extension was built in 1968 linking this to the current entrance on Suffolk Street Queensway.
The new look was unveiled in time for the opening night of West End hit Motown the Musical yesterday (11th October).
